cheshire@Neon.Stanford.EDU (Stuart David Cheshire) (01/25/91)

In article <1991Jan23.163734.13268@midway.uchicago.edu> dwal@ellis.uchicago.edu (David Walton) writes:

... loads of stuff about printing

What's the matter with you all? Go and try it. YES, Apple have updated the
printing guidelines. Imagewriter, Imagewriter LQ etc. all work the same --
print settings, like the choice of printer itself in the Chooser, are global,
preserved even across restart.
